| Chain Codes is one of the coding expressing methods for the verge of the contour of the objects. It makes full use of a series of lines with special length and direction to express the verge of the objects. On account of the limited length and the numbered directions, the jumping-off points of the verge must be expressed with absolute coordinate value, and the others' offsets can be represented by the following direction-value. The demanded byte-number of representing one direction is smaller than the one of representing one coordinate-value, and to one point, a direction-number can represent two coordinate-values, as a result, chain codes can reduce the numbers of data, which are necessary for the verge expression. The digital images are composed of griddling with fixed space between each other, so the simplest chain codes is following the verge and give the direction-value to the linked line of every two adjacent pixels.The work includes:(1) According to the chain codes, the paper gives a practical method to calculate the target area.(2)  According to the chain codes, the paper gives a new method to judge the contour direction.(3)  According to the chain codes, the paper gives a powerful and correctly contour filling method.(4)  According to the chain codes, the paper gives a new dilation and erosion method.(5)  According to the chain codes, the paper gives a practical method to detect line.Chain Codes is propitious to the calculation of characteristics of objects, such as target area, perimeter, inflexion and the pick-up line, etc. In fact, Chain code has become one of the most common tools in image and processing and pattern recognition. In this paper, we reconsidered the existing algorithm and put forward the more practical methods. |